Isothenuria specific gravity range
1.008 - 1.012
Isosthenuria indicates…
- > 70% nephrons are non-functional
- severe kidney disease
- end stage kidney disease/failure
- inability of kidney to concentrate/dilute urine
Amorphous crystals
- crystals with no defining shape
- little clinical significance
Is cloudy urine normal in horse?
Yes, because horse tends to absorb excessive calcium from intestine and eliminate it via urine, giving the urine a cloudy appearance.
Mucus also adds to the cloudiness.

What are the 3 ketone bodies?
- Acetoacetate
- Beta-hydroxybutyric acid
- Acetone (least abundant)
Where and why ketone bodies are being produced?
Ketone bodies are produced by liver to serve as alternative energy source when glucose is not readily available.
Ketonuria interpretation
- Starvation
- Diabetes mellitus
- Excessive fat in diet
- Ketosis (cattle)
- Pregnancy toxaemia (sheep)
Glucosuria interpretation
- Diabetes mellitus
- Stress induced glucosuria
- Pancreatic necrosis
- Drug induced glucosuria
- Hyperadrenocorticism
Bilirubinuria interpretation
- Hemolytic diseases (pre-hepatic)
- Hepatocellular diseases (hepatic)
- Bile duct obstruction (post-hepatic)
